#60d75c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#60d75c is composed of 37.6% red, 84.3%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.2%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 118 degrees, a saturation of 60.6% and a lightness of 60.2%. #60d75c color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ffb8 with #00af00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#60d75c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a03 is the darkest color, while #fafef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#60d75c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#93a093 is the less saturated color, while #3cfe35 is the most saturated one.
